Overview

Postcode RH15 9BU is located in an urban city, within the Burgess Hill Meeds & Hammonds ward of Mid Sussex in the South East region, and forms part of the Burgess Hill Central area. It has moderate deprivation and high crime levels, with around 101.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Burgess Hill Central is £48,000 per year. The nearest station is Burgess Hill located about 0.3 miles away. There are 8 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, closest medium park is St John's Park.

Property prices in Burgess Hill Meeds & Hammonds

Based on 105 recent sales, the median property price is £405,000 in Burgess Hill Meeds & Hammonds area, with individual transactions ranging from £139,500 up to £870,000.
